Energy-Saving Non-Drying Continuous Production Compound Fertilizer Granulation Line for NPK Fertilizer
Traditional fertilizer processing demands high energy consumption due to massive rotary dryers. As a premier fertilizer plant manufacturer, we have engineered the revolutionary Energy-Saving Non-Drying Compound Fertilizer Granulation Line to eliminate this costly step. This advanced low energy fertilizer plant utilizes ambient-temperature dry press technology, bypassing fluid beds or fuel-burning equipment entirely. Driven by our heavy-duty non-drying fertilizer granulator, this complete compound fertilizer line handles raw materials at room temperature, delivering hard, high-density granules while slashing your factory electricity and fuel expenses.
- Ultimate Thermal Cost Savings: By eliminating the rotary dryer and cooling drum, this no dryer granulation process slashes operational gas and coal consumption to absolute zero.
- Instant Compaction & Shaping: High-pressure double rollers achieve immediate dry agglomeration, allowing raw materials to be molded and packed in a continuous, rapid cycle.
- Compact Plant Footprint: The absence of bulky thermal systems reduces the required floor space by 40%, significantly minimizing your initial factory infrastructure investment.
- Heavy-Duty Structural Longevity: Built for 24/7 continuous industrial operation, the main non-drying fertilizer granulator features enclosed oil-bath lubrication and hardened alloy gears.

Unlike wet granulation systems, this low energy fertilizer plant operates on a streamlined, dry-powder physical compaction framework:
- Precision Feed Dosing: The continuous automated batching unit utilizes weight-loss feeders to systematically dose raw urea, ammonium chloride, and potash powders based on your commercial target formulas.
- Intensive Dry Blending: A heavy-duty horizontal double-shaft mixer quickly agitates the dry ingredients, ensuring a completely homogeneous powder matrix before the mixture enters the compaction stage.
- Low-Temperature Roller Compactor: The mixed dry powder drops directly into the non-drying fertilizer granulator. Two internal rollers exert massive hydraulic force, compressing the loose powder into ultra-dense solid sheets at room temperature.
- Mechanical Granule Breaking: The solid compressed sheets are instantly transferred to an under-roller breaking system, where customized claw-style teeth mechanically crush and slice the flakes into raw granular particles.
- Sizing & Multi-Stage Screening: The broken particles enter a high-frequency rotary sifter. Standard commercial granules are separated and directed forward, while fine dust and oversized pieces are automatically caught by a recycling loop.
- Eco-Friendly Closed-Loop Recirculation: Undersized powder and crushed oversized materials are fed right back into the main hopper via an enclosed belt conveyor, achieving a 100% material utilization rate with zero waste.
- Micro-Membrane Granule Coating: Qualified particles enter a compact rotary coating drum. A thin layer of anti-caking oil or protective glazing powder is applied to ensure the granules remain free-flowing during maritime shipping.
- Digital Quantitative Bagging: The final coated compound fertilizer moves into an automated packing station, where it is measured, filled into 25kg/50kg woven bags, and thread-sealed for immediate commercial shipping.
